What Is Nadsfit.com?
Nadsfit.com is identified as a Trojan-type threat, which means it is a type of malware that can disguise itself as legitimate software or hide within other programs to gain unauthorized access to your computer. Trojans are known for their ability to create backdoors, allowing hackers to control your system remotely, steal sensitive information, or install additional malware.
How Nadsfit.com Operates
Trojan-type threats like Nadsfit.com typically operate by exploiting vulnerabilities in your system's security or by tricking users into installing them. Once installed, they can perform a variety of malicious actions, including but not limited to, data theft, keystroke logging, and the installation of other types of malware. They can also disrupt system performance, cause crashes, or alter system settings without your permission.
Symptoms of Infection
Identifying a Trojan infection can be challenging because these threats are designed to remain hidden. However, some common symptoms may indicate the presence of Nadsfit.com or similar malware. These include unexpected system crashes, unfamiliar programs or icons on your desktop, unusual network activity, and significant decreases in system performance. Additionally, you might notice that your browser settings have been altered, or you're being redirected to unwanted websites.
How to Remove Nadsfit.com
- Enter Safe Mode with Networking to limit the malware's ability to interfere with the removal process. This mode allows you to use the internet to download necessary tools while minimizing system functionality to prevent the malware from spreading or causing further damage.
- Perform a full scan of your system using a reputable anti-malware tool, such as SpyHunter. Ensure the tool is updated with the latest definitions to improve the chances of detecting and removing Nadsfit.com.
- Uninstall suspicious programs that you do not recognize or that were installed around the time you noticed the symptoms of the infection. Be cautious and only remove programs you are certain are not essential to your system's operation.
- Reset your browsers (Chrome, Firefox, Edge, etc.) to their default settings. This can help remove any malicious extensions or settings that Nadsfit.com might have altered. After resetting, ensure you change any passwords you've used, especially if you've used the same passwords for other accounts.
- After completing the above steps, reboot your system and then perform another full scan with your anti-malware tool to ensure that Nadsfit.com and any associated malware are completely removed.
